With the final ruling for Ripple vs SEC looming, anticipation mounts as the crypto industry and Americans at the large question the SEC’s regulatory actions. As Ripple and the SEC engage in an ongoing legal battle over the classification of XRP, Ripple’s top lawyer, Stuart Alderoty, has voiced strong criticism against the SEC’s approach.

SEC as a Weapon: Alderoty’s Critique

In a recent tweet, Ripple’s top lawyer, Stuart Alderoty, accuses the SEC of using the legal process as a weapon and engaging in a game of “hide and seek” to avoid Congressional oversight. Alderoty emphasizes that this issue extends beyond the crypto industry, impacting the rights of all Americans.

The Biggest Question: Is XRP a Security?

At the heart of the legal battle between Ripple and the SEC lies the question of XRP’s classification. The SEC alleges that Ripple sold XRP through unregistered securities transactions, arguing that its distribution shares similarities with securities offerings. Ripple, on the other hand, firmly maintains that XRP is a digital currency and lacks the necessary attributes to be classified as a security.

A Pattern of Supreme Court Losses

Highlighting the SEC’s track record, Alderoty points out the regulatory agency’s recent losses in the Supreme Court, including the SEC v. Cochran case. This reference underscores the need for precise regulation in the rapidly evolving world of digital assets, as the ongoing Ripple vs SEC lawsuit captures significant attention from the crypto industry.

Anticipation for a Resolution

As the legal battle continues, Alderoty anticipates a resolution for the Ripple vs SEC case within the first half of this year. The outcome of this case will not only impact Ripple and the SEC but also shape the future of regulatory frameworks in the cryptocurrency space.
